Free Agent Montrezl Harrell Switches Sides in Los Angeles

Reigning NBA Sixth Man of the Year and Cardinal forever Montrezl Harrell has found himself a new team. Harrell has signed a 2 year/$19 million dollar contract with the Los Angeles Lakers, details first reported by Adrian Wojnarowski of ESPN.

After spending his first two season playing a limited role in Houston, Harrell flourished off the bench with the Los Angeles Clippers the past three years. He won the league’s Sixth Man of the Year Award in 2020 after posting career highs in points (18.6 per game) and rebounds (7.1).

Harrell joins the Lebron James and the reigning NBA champions. The NBA season tips off on Dec. 22.
